         Mr. Chairman and Members of the Subcommittee:

              We welcome the opportunity to appear before this Subcom-

         mittee to discuss some of the issues related to developing
         Federal coal resources and the Government's ability to effec-

         tively administer a development program. As you know, the

         GAO has been deeply involved in reviews of issues affecting

         the development of this Nation's vast coal resources. My

*        testimony is based on our piished reports to the Congress

*and on recently completed work. We are also ir the process

         of drafting reports on that work and we hope to complete

         and publish them soon.

              There is no question that coal will play an important

         part in the Nation's energy future. The relative importance

         of coal as an energy source, however, will largely be shaped

         by policies yet to be developed.
